Consultative and diagnostic assistance is carried out for the following conditions:
-
1. Reproductive problems (infertility; habitual abortion; recurrent pregnancy loss; planning and preparation to treatment with ART methods (IVF, AIHS (Artificial insemination with husband's semen), etc.); high-risk pregnancy follow-up, including after IVF; ultrasound prenatal diagnosis of the fetus at all periods of pregnancy)
-
2. Hormonal disorders in different age groups: all types of gynecological endocrinopathies (abnormal menstruation, amenorrhea, PCOS, hyperprolactinemia, etc.)
-
3. Menopausal disorders (diagnosis and treatment of menopausal syndrome, osteoporosis, menopausal metabolic syndrome, genitourinary menopausal syndrome, etc.)
-
4. Cervix pathologies (pseudo-erosion (ectropion), HPV-associated diseases (cervical condyloma, CIN) etc.)
-
5. Contraception planning and hormone replacement therapy and calculation complications risks using genetic passport data and individual clinical and anamnestic data
-
6. Personalized preventive examinations for detection of an existing pathology and prediction of a possible reproductive disease development in order to work out an individual prevention and treatment program
The important direction of the department work is the surgical treatment of diseases of female reproductive system. The North-West Center of Minimally Invasive Gynecologic Surgery operates as a part of the department. The great majority of surgeries are endoscopic (hysteroscopic/laparoscopic).
The surgical treatment is performed for the following pathologies:
-
uterine myoma,
-
benign ovarian tumors,
-
common types of endometriosis,
-
intrauterine pathology (polyps, endometrial hyperplasia, intrauterine synechia, etc.),
-
cervical pathology (ectropion, leukoplakia, dysplasia, carcinoma in situ),
-
pelvic prolapse,
-
urinary incontinence in women.
The department has accumulated experience in the non-surgical treatment of the cervical precancer (CIN) by photodynamic therapy (PDT) with a high cure rate.
Gynecological oncology (Oncogynecology)
Among the specialists of the department the oncologist works, several doctors in addition to obstetrics and gynecology are also certified in oncology. Patients with malignant diseases of the cervix, uterus and ovaries receive a consultative and surgical help.
In the department surgical staging procedures in cases of female tract malignant diseases are performed, as well as surgical treatment in different volumes:
-
Uterine cancer – total/radical hysterectomy with bilateral salpingo-oophorectomy (laparoscopy or laparotomy)
-
Cervical cancer – Wertheim’s hysterectomy (with ovarian preservation and transposition, if necessary)
-
Ovarian cancer – Primary or Interval Debulking surgery.
